Body massage is a fast growing profession, with the demand for therapists in the field growing by the day. However, before enrolling in any educational facility to take a course in this area, there are a number of factors to consider. The massage schools are required to be registered and accredited by the relevant government authorities. It is not possible to get the practicing license unless you are trained in an accredited school.

Currently, there are hundreds of massage schools that offer this course, and you have to make the right choice. It is not easy, and you need to be equipped with the right information before settling on a particular school. The types of courses offered are very important. This is a vocational training and the courses can be in full time or art time. In addition to this, they may be diploma courses, certificate courses, or even entry level courses. The right choice is determined by your budget, the type of practicing license required and your time schedule.

To start with, consider the courses on offer. There should be a variety of courses being offered in the massage school so you would have several options on the types of the course you can take and certification you want or need to have. Since massage therapy is a vocational course, the options the school can offer may cover a diploma course, short course, and a certificate IV or entry level course.

You will also see if the school is credible and if their courses are well-structured if, even before enrollment, they can provide you with a clear curriculum or outline of the subjects which will be covered in each course.

If allowed, get time to sit in a class at different massage schools before registering officially. In this way, you get a first-hand experience on how the institution conducts its affairs. It also helps you make a realistic comparison when choosing one facility from many. Getting the feeling of how the learning progress is conducted also helps you adapt faster when you finally start the classes.

Additionally, make sure to consider the program content. Does the curriculum cover all the basics plus a little more of what is needed to complete the course successfully? More than that, does the program content prepare for work in the real world? Ask to see the curriculum of this course and ask if the curriculum meets state requirements.
